India’s Hydrogen Power Play
Hydrogen-powered turbines could help India decarbonise electricity, industry and eventually aviation but formidable challenges remain. Hydrogen has acquired the status of energy’s favourite future tense. It promises clean industrial heat, low-carbon electricity and, eventually, cleaner aviation.
